[ ] Key ceremony step 7 — SpoolHive printer-spooler microservice. Before sealing the release envelope, confirm both custodians from the Larkfield office have witnessed the HSM export, verify the checksum against the ceremony ledger, and record the timestamp in the Quillware release log. Once witnessed, the escrow bundle must be archived with the recovery passphrase noted directly below.

unlock words, hahip-baduf: holwyn-istath-julvan

The Quillbend tax-rate cache (service: ratehold) refreshes jurisdiction tables every 6 hours. Support: do not clear the cache during business hours; stale rates are preferable to cold-start latency.

Key variables in `.env`:

- `RATEHOLD_TTL_HOURS` — default 6
- `RATEHOLD_REGION_SET` — comma-separated region codes
- `RATEHOLD_FALLBACK_MODE` — `stale` or `deny`

Upstream rate feeds require authentication. The cache will not warm without it and every lookup will 503. Add the upstream feed credential on the next line of the env file.

vault entry, bagep-yahip: VAULT_KEY8=d2a227e5

## PR: Resolve double-booking in Meridelle calendar sync

This change addresses the conflict where events edited offline in Meridelle and concurrently on the Oakhaven server produced duplicate entries after sync. We now compare vector timestamps per event and apply a deterministic merge, preferring the later edit and logging the loser for audit. I've verified round-trips across three device states. The merge window and retry behavior are controlled by the constants below.

limits module of kawef-hawef:
TIERS = {
    "belax": 967,
    "gorvan": 210,
    "ulair": 473,
}

Quarterly Planning Note — Insurance Renewal

Our combined liability cover with Ashgrove Mutual expires at quarter end. The renewal quote reflects an 11% premium increase, largely attributable to the expanded Farrowgate warehouse. Brokers are benchmarking two alternative carriers, and a recommendation will follow within three weeks. Department heads should review the coverage schedule against the considerations noted below.

confidential, kagup-bafog: Fraaxax Group is in early talks to buy Soroxox Group for about $343.8 million. The Olidor launch date is June 14, and nothing goes to the press before then. Legal wants the Aldmirek Logistics term sheet signed before July 23.